Kalamazoo bakery grand opening fueled by Michigan Women Forward Support

KALAMAZOO, Mich. — Kristi Potts, a Kalamazoo native and longtime community baker, officially opened her storefront for KZOO Cream Frosted Whispers Cookies Tuesday afternoon in the Vine neighborhood.

The grand opening featured a ceremonial ribbon-cutting as supporters, including Mayor David Anderson, first responders, friends, family, and local residents, cheered on the launch.

Potts has baked since childhood, perfecting her mother’s cream-cheese sugar cookies alongside her mom, who has since been diagnosed with Parkinson’s disease, as a way of preserving cherished memories.
